Historical Context and Definition

Crash-style gameplay, often associated with vehicular destruction titles and physics sandbox genres, roots back to classic arcade hits of the 1980s and 1990s. Titles such as Destruction Derby and Burnout series introduced players to exhilarating collision-based challenges, where the thrill lay in maximising damage while maintaining control. These games employed physics engines that simulated real-world impacts, creating unpredictable yet captivating scenarios.

Today, modern iterations leverage advancements in physics simulation, offering destructible environments, ragdoll effects, and real-time damage calculations. This evolution demonstrates the industry’s commitment to delivering authentic chaos and emergent gameplay, fuelled by improved computational capabilities and player demand for visceral experiences.

Technical Foundations and Industry Insights

The underpinning technology of crash-style gameplay involves sophisticated physics engines such as Havok, PhysX, or proprietary solutions. These systems enable realistic collision detection, dynamic deformation, and fluid animation of shattered objects.
